Reviewer 1 Report

The Authors investigated the role of DWI based on MIP to improve the diagnostic performance in young breast cancer patients having relevant enhancing on contrast-enhanced breast MRI. The topic is of interest, given the important role of breast MRI in the diagnostic assessment of breast lesions and as a driver of subsequent therapeutic management. I have few comments:

 

Introduction

1)     What do you mean by histologic enhancement ? Is it correct (line 38).

2)     I suggest to breafly explain the concept of DWI and MIP to the readers in the introduction.

3)     Why did you choose to focus on young breast cancer patients? Frequency of BPE in this population?

 

M&M

1)     What is your definition of young ? < 60? I am not sure it is applicable to breast cancer.

2)     I would not define as old age > 60. Please just use < 60 as definition of your population and > 60 for exclusion criteria.

3)     What do you mean by absence of surgical history? (line 63).

4)     1.303 MRI scans: But how many patients?

5)     Histopathology review (lines 147-166). Please explain all the acronyms used (ER, PR, HER2, et al)

 

Results

 

1)     Line 181-186. I would move these lines into M&M -study population section.

2)     Table 1. I assume the numbers in the third column have different dimension (years, mm, number, et al). Please specify.

3)     Table 1 and 2, captions. Please explain here also ca, SD, IQR.

Suitable for publication after revision.
